The NBA has had so many legends over its 75+ years of history that it is tough to compare one generation with the other. Nonetheless, we make all-time teams trying to ascertain who are the best pure players. Michael Jordan and LeBron James often end up No. 1 and No. 2 on these lists, but not for Julius Erving.
Erving’s all-time starting five does not include Jordan and LeBron, but it does include old-school legends like Bill Russell and Wilt Chamberlain.
“When we pick my all-time team, you know we got thousands of players, that was 55 years ago. But I made my team and it’s still my team. Wilt and Russell, killers. Jerry West, Oscar Roberston, and Elgin Baylor. That’s my team right there.”

Julius Erving Didn’t Want To Add Michael Jordan And LeBron James On His Mount Rushmore
This isn’t the first time Erving has constructed a list like this. He has maintained his starting five for years now. He was asked to name his NBA Mount Rushmore in 2022 but he ignored Jordan and LeBron once again, naming the exact five players (for a four-person Mount Rushmore) again in that interview.
“I’d say it’s Bill Russell and Wilt Chamberlain, and it’s Oscar Robertson, and it’s Jerry West, and it’s Elgin Baylor. Since when I was 15 years old, those were the guys. They were the mainstay of the day, and what they did and how they did it made an indelible impression on me forever. Put those guys on the court against anybody, and they would win. That’s my team, and that will always be my team.”
Different strokes for different folks. Erving has shown incredible consistency with the names he mentions as the greatest in his eyes. However, not being able to appreciate what the generations of players that have come after him have achieved is not appreciated.
Julius Erving’s Controversial All-Time List Without LeBron James And Kobe Bryant
When the list is expanded to more than five people, Erving has no choice but to relent and include Michael Jordan and other players from his era and beyond. But it seems the Jordan era is where he draws the line, as he was once asked to name a top-10 all-time list where he still ignored LeBron along with Kobe Bryant.
“I’ve got five guys that are untouchable… Bill Russell, Wilt Chamberlain, Oscar Robertson, Jerry West, and Elgin Baylor. That’s my all-time best team… There’s no order really, the next group of guys would be Kareem Abdul-Jabbar, Michael Jordan, Earvin Magic Johnson, and probably Karl Malone… I like Tiny Archibald.” (9:38)
Tiny Archibald averaged 18.8 points and 7.4 assists in the NBA and won one title. His achievements are great for his time, but Kobe is a five-time champion who averaged 25.0 points, 5.2 rebounds, and 4.7 assists for his career while James is a four-time champion, the league’s all-time leading scorer, and someone who’s averaged 27.2 points, 7.5 rebounds, and 7.3 assists for his career.
